Promoting ASEAN - Japan youth friendship through a cultural programme

Monday, 03/12/2018 10:34
On December 2nd, the 45th Ship for Southeast Asian and Japanese Youth Program (SSEAYP) docked at Cat Lai Port in Ho Chi Minh city to promote friendship among the youth of participating countries, broaden their perspectives of the world and strengthen their spirit and skills for international cooperation.

Delegates wave their hands to greet Vietnamese people (Source: tuoitre.vn)
The ship carried 326 young delegates from ten ASEAN countries and Japan.

The delegates and 500 young people from Ho Chi Minh city enjoyed cultural exchange showing the specific culture of each country. They will take part in a range of cultural exchange activities, visit schools, interact with the city’s students and youths and live with local residents to experience the daily life of Vietnamese families until December 5th.

The SSEAYP is an annual youth exchange program sponsored by the Japanese Government and supported by the members of the Association of Southeast Asian Nations (ASEAN) since 1974, during which participants have an opportunity to live together on board the Nippon Maru Ship for over 50 days./.
